About 9 Eccleston Avenue

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

9 Eccleston Avenue is a semi-detached house in Bromborough, Wirral, Wirral (CH62 2EB). It has a recorded floor area of 101 m² (around 1087 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(June 2024) shows a C (score 69), just inside the C band.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 83).

It changed hands recently, sold January 2025 for £141,000. Today's modelled estimate of £191,000 is 35.5% above the 2025 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£130/sq ft) was about 20.5%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
